GroupDocs.Conversion .NET을 사용하여 PowerPoint 프레젠테이션을 고품질 이미지로 변환하세요

소개

PowerPoint(PPTX) 프레젠테이션을 JPG 이미지로 변환하는 것은 웹사이트에 쉽게 공유하고 삽입하는 데 필수적입니다. 이 튜토리얼에서는 .NET용 GroupDocs.Conversion PPTX 슬라이드를 효율적으로 개별 JPG 이미지로 변환하여 모든 플랫폼에서 접근 가능한 고품질 시각적 콘텐츠를 보장합니다.

이 기사에서는 다음 내용을 다루겠습니다.

  • GroupDocs.Conversion이 파일 변환을 용이하게 하는 방법
  • 필요한 환경 및 라이브러리 설정
  • PPTX에서 JPG로 변환하는 단계별 구현

이 가이드를 마치면 .NET 애플리케이션에서 GroupDocs.Conversion을 활용하는 방법을 확실히 이해하게 될 것입니다. 코딩하기 전에 필요한 것부터 시작해 보겠습니다.

필수 조건

우리가 여행을 시작하기 전에 .NET용 GroupDocs.Conversion, 다음 사항을 준비했는지 확인하세요.

  • .NET 라이브러리용 GroupDocs.Conversion: 25.3.0 이상 버전을 사용하고 있는지 확인하세요.
  • 개발 환경: 컴퓨터에 Visual Studio와 .NET Framework가 설치되어 있어야 합니다.
  • 기본 C# 지식: 따라가려면 C# 프로그래밍 개념에 익숙해야 합니다.

.NET용 GroupDocs.Conversion 설정

시작하려면 GroupDocs.Conversion 라이브러리를 설치하세요. 다음 방법 중 하나를 사용하여 프로젝트에 추가할 수 있습니다.

NuGet 패키지 관리자 콘솔

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

면허 취득

모든 기능을 사용하려면 GroupDocs.Conversion, 라이센스 취득을 고려하세요:

  • 무료 체험: 무료 체험판을 통해 기능을 살펴보세요.
  • 임시 면허: 장기 테스트를 위해 임시 라이센스를 받으세요.
  • 구입: 상업적으로 사용해야 하는 경우 라이센스를 구매하세요.

프로젝트에서 GroupDocs.Conversion을 초기화하고 설정하는 방법은 다음과 같습니다.

using GroupDocs.Conversion;

구현 가이드

PPTX를 JPG로 변환

개요

이 기능은 PowerPoint 파일(PPTX)을 로드하고 각 슬라이드를 JPG 형식으로 변환하는 방법을 보여줍니다. 이 기능은 썸네일을 만들거나 웹 애플리케이션에 프레젠테이션을 통합하는 데 유용합니다.

1단계: 경로 정의 먼저, 소스 문서와 출력 디렉토리에 대한 경로를 지정하세요.

string sourceFilePath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.pptx");
string outputFolder = Path.Combine("YOUR_OUTPUT_DIRECTORY");
string outputFileTemplate = Path.Combine(outputFolder, "converted-page-{0}.jpg");

2단계: 스트림 생성 기능 변환된 각 페이지의 스트림을 처리하는 함수를 만듭니다.

Func<SavePageContext, Stream> getPageStream = savePageContext =>
    new FileStream(string.Format(outputFileTemplate, savePageContext.Page), FileMode.Create);

3단계: GroupDocs.Conversion을 사용하여 로드 및 변환 다음을 사용하여 PPTX 파일을 로드합니다. Converter 클래스 및 설정 변환 옵션:

using (Converter converter = new Converter(sourceFilePath))
{
    ImageConvertOptions options = new ImageConvertOptions { Format = ImageFileType.Jpg };
    converter.Convert(getPageStream, options);
}

설명:

  • Converter: PPTX 파일을 로드합니다.
  • ImageConvertOptions: 출력 형식(JPG) 등의 변환 설정을 구성합니다.
  • getPageStream: JPG로 변환된 각 슬라이드에 대한 스트림을 생성합니다.

문제 해결 팁

  • 경로가 올바르게 지정되어 접근 가능한지 확인하세요.
  • GroupDocs.Conversion이 프로젝트에 제대로 설치되고 참조되는지 확인하세요.

변환 옵션 구성

개요

변환 옵션을 구성하면 출력 형식을 지정하고 이미지 파일의 해상도나 품질과 같은 설정을 조정할 수 있습니다. 이 기능은 특정 요구에 맞게 변환을 조정하는 데 필수적입니다.

1단계: ImageConvertOptions 만들기 변환 매개변수를 설정하세요.

ImageConvertOptions options = new ImageConvertOptions { Format = ImageFileType.Jpg };

설명:

  • Format: 출력 파일 형식을 결정합니다(이 경우 JPG).

이러한 옵션을 설정하면 PPTX 슬라이드가 이미지로 렌더링되는 방식을 제어할 수 있습니다.

실제 응용 프로그램

PPTX를 JPG로 변환하는 방법을 이해하면 다양한 실제 응용 프로그램이 열립니다.

  1. 웹 통합: 웹사이트에 고품질 슬라이드 썸네일을 삽입합니다.
  2. 문서 관리 시스템: 쉽게 접근할 수 있는 이미지 파일로 콘텐츠 관리를 개선합니다.
  3. 모바일 앱: 파일 크기가 중요한 모바일 애플리케이션에서 변환된 슬라이드를 사용합니다.

성능 고려 사항

GroupDocs.Conversion을 사용할 때 효율적인 성능을 보장하려면:

  • 스트림을 효과적으로 관리하여 리소스 사용을 최적화합니다.
  • 누수를 방지하기 위해 불필요한 객체를 삭제하는 등 .NET 메모리 관리의 모범 사례를 따릅니다.

이러한 지침을 염두에 두면 변환하는 동안 최적의 애플리케이션 성능을 유지할 수 있습니다.

결론

이 튜토리얼에서는 PPTX 파일을 JPG 이미지로 변환하는 방법을 안내합니다. .NET용 GroupDocs.Conversion환경 설정부터 변환 옵션 구성, 실용적인 애플리케이션 및 최적화 팁까지 모든 것을 다루었습니다.

다음 단계

기술을 더욱 향상시키려면:

  • GroupDocs.Conversion의 추가 기능을 살펴보세요.
  • 다양한 파일 형식과 변환 설정을 실험해 보세요.

행동 촉구: 오늘부터 여러분의 프로젝트에 이 솔루션을 구현해 보세요!

FAQ 섹션

  1. GroupDocs.Conversion에 필요한 최소 .NET 버전은 무엇입니까?

    • GroupDocs.Conversion을 사용하려면 최소 .NET Framework 4.0 이상이 필요합니다.
  2. GroupDocs.Conversion을 사용하여 다른 파일 형식을 변환할 수 있나요?

    • 네, PPTX와 JPG 외에도 다양한 문서 및 이미지 형식을 지원합니다.
  3. 변환하는 동안 큰 파일을 어떻게 처리하나요?

    • 스트림 관리 기술을 활용하고 리소스 할당을 최적화하여 보다 나은 처리를 제공합니다.
  4. GroupDocs.Conversion을 사용하면 일괄 처리를 지원합니까?

    • 네, 여러 파일을 일괄 처리로 변환하여 작업 흐름을 간소화할 수 있습니다.
  5. GroupDocs.Conversion에 대한 추가 자료는 어디에서 찾을 수 있나요?

    • 방문하세요 GroupDocs 문서 포괄적인 가이드와 예제는 API 참조에서 확인하세요.

자원